WebAn extended use study of horses on Prascend (24 to 36 months) supported this historical knowledge. The drug is prescribed for once daily administration. Another drug which works at the level of the pituitary gland and brain is cyproheptadine. This drug is a serotonin antagonist and works indirectly to achieve similar effects as pergolide. Webthe dopamine agonist pergolide (initial dose is 2g/kg po sid), which is licensed for the treatment of this condition in horses in the UK. It is reportedly effective in 65 per cent to 80 per cent of cases. The serotonin antagonist cyproheptadine does not appear to be any more effective than non-pharmacological management.
